(Video) Sabah Firefighter Demonstrates The Power Of A King Cobra’s Bite

Firefighters do a lot more than fight fires because they also catch snakes. However, it does beg the question: are they outfitted to deal with these scaly reptiles? Well, according to these local firefighters, the King Cobra is a special situation.

Facebook user Farid Squad King Cobra is a firefighter and snake catcher supposedly stationed in Sabah. Recently, he debunked whether their firefighter boots were capable of fending off a King Cobra’s bite. Needless to say, the results proved to be fascinating for many netizens.

Farid first uploaded a video showing their personnel masterfully toying with a snake, luring it to strike. But, it also prompted a question from netizens: “If the tactical boots get struck, would they get punctured?” Farid claimed the boots would be fine if struck by a King Cobra, but would get punctured if bitten. To prove the claim, Farid posted a video showing what he meant on 14th February.

The footage showed a firefighter displaying their boot to a King Cobra and how when the snake bit into the boot, its fangs punctured the boot, even squeezing enough venom out for it to drip down the sides of the footwear. He also had to pry the snake’s mouth open to detach it from the boot, sharing this was how dangerous the King Cobra’s bite was.

Netizens were impressed by the display, with several praising the firefighter’s bravery in handling the snake. A few questioned if it was capable of puncturing jeans, which Farid claimed it would. He also advised netizens to wear closed shoes when walking in bushy areas, and to seek treatment immediately if bitten.
